分布式文件系统元数据管理方法、装置、设备及存储介质制造方法及图纸

技术编号:33777773 阅读:23 留言:0更新日期:2022-06-12 14:31
本申请涉及云存储领域,具体公开了一种分布式文件系统元数据管理方法、装置、设备及存储介质,所述分布式文件系统包括至少一个元数据节点,所述方法包括:获取待存储元数据和所述待存储元数据的数据类型,并确定所述待存储元数据的索引条目和目录条目;从至少一个所述元数据节点中确定所述待存储元数据的父目录的父索引条目所在的目标元数据节点,并将所述目录条目保存在所述目标元数据节点;根据所述待存储元数据的数据类型在至少一个所述元数据节点中确定索引保存节点,并将所述索引条目保存在所述索引保存节点。保存在所述索引保存节点。保存在所述索引保存节点。

【技术实现步骤摘要】
分布式文件系统元数据管理方法、装置、设备及存储介质


[0001]本申请涉及数据处理领域,尤其涉及一种分布式文件系统元数据管理方法、装置、设备及存储介质。

技术介绍

[0002]分布式文件系统由于需要提供如权限、创建更新时间、文件大小和文件锁等各种元数据信息和管理接口,因此其复杂程度在分布式存储系统中是首屈一指。而这些系统调用需求的功能大都需要由元数据来实现的,这也导致元数据成为文件系统访问的热点所在,所以元数据实现的是好是坏对系统成功与否至关重要。

技术实现思路

[0003]本申请提供了一种分布式文件系统元数据管理方法、装置、设备及存储介质,以提高访问的便捷性。
[0004]第一方面,本申请提供了一种分布式文件系统元数据管理方法,所述分布式文件系统包括至少一个元数据节点,所述方法包括:
[0005]获取待存储元数据和所述待存储元数据的数据类型,并确定所述待存储元数据的索引条目和目录条目;
[0006]从至少一个所述元数据节点中确定所述待存储元数据的父目录的父索引条目所在的目标元数据节点,并将所述目录条目保本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种分布式文件系统元数据管理方法,其特征在于,所述分布式文件系统包括至少一个元数据节点,所述方法包括:获取待存储元数据和所述待存储元数据的数据类型,并确定所述待存储元数据的索引条目和目录条目;从至少一个所述元数据节点中确定所述待存储元数据的父目录的父索引条目所在的目标元数据节点,并将所述目录条目保存在所述目标元数据节点;根据所述待存储元数据的数据类型在至少一个所述元数据节点中确定索引保存节点,并将所述索引条目保存在所述索引保存节点。2.根据权利要求1所述的分布式文件系统元数据管理方法,其特征在于,所述根据所述待存储元数据的数据类型在至少一个所述元数据节点中确定索引保存节点,包括:若所述待存储元数据的数据类型为目录数据,则基于至少一个所述元数据节点的节点余量确定索引保存节点;若所述待存储元数据的数据类型为文件数据,则确定所述目标元数据节点为索引保存节点。3.根据权利要求2所述的分布式文件系统元数据管理方法,其特征在于,所述索引保存节点包括多个数据实例,所述将所述索引条目保存在所述索引保存节点,包括:基于所述待存储元数据的数据类型进行预设规则的哈希计算,从多个所述数据实例中确定所述索引条目的保存实例,并基于所述保存实例对所述索引条目进行保存。4.根据权利要求3所述的分布式文件系统元数据管理方法,其特征在于,所述基于所述待存储元数据的数据类型进行预设规则的哈希计算,包括:若所述待存储元数据的数据类型为目录数据,则根据所述待存储元数据的索引条目进行哈希计算;若所述待存储元数据的数据类型为文件数据,则根据所述待存储元数据的父目录的索引条目进行哈希计算。5.根据权利要求1所述的分布式文件系统元数据管理方法,其特征在于,所述方法还包括:获取所述待存储数据的扩展属性条目,并将所述扩展属性条目保存在所述索引保存节点。6.根据权...

【专利技术属性】
技术研发人员:郑哲欣
申请(专利权)人:平安科技深圳有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1